Indicative MoodHaber kipleri shows the state of the verb in tense (time) and person.. These are called Indicative Moods.
Present Continuous Tense (Şimdiki Zaman Kipi)This tense describes what is happening now at this moment, It is also used for happenings in the near future The Present Tense Suffix "-yor" (-ing) does not follow vowel harmony rules and always retains the "-yor-" form.. Simple Present Tense (Geniş Zaman Kipi)This tense signifies habitual action. The Simple Present Suffix (according to vowel harmony ) is: -ar, -er, -ır, -ir, -ur, -ür, -r. Past (-di'li) Definite TenseThis is the eyewitness tense and it states that something definitely happened in the past: The suffixes for this tense are: -di, -dı -du, -dü, -ti, -tı -tu, -tü. These suffixes are used for the Past definite tense (-di'li geçmiş zamanı). Past (-miş'li) Indefinite TenseThis tense is use for hearsay and reporting, it is used when the event has not been eye witnessed personally. This tens is used for tales and jokes. The suffixes for this tense are: -muş, -mış, -miş, -müş. These suffixes are used for the Past Indefinite Tense (-miş'li geçmiş zamanı). The Future tense (Gelecek Zaman Kipi)This tense signifies what will happen in the future The Future Tense suffix (according to Vowel harmony ) is -acak, -ecek. After verb roots ending in a vowel it uses buffer letter -y- to become -yacak, -yecek Wish or diseire (Dilek Kipleri)This tense signifies wish or desire.
Necessitative Tense (Gereklilik Kipi)This tense signifies obligation (must.. should.. ought to..). This tense's suffix according to vowel harmony is: -meli, -malı. Tense of desire (İstek Kipi)This tense signifies a wish or desire "Let me.. let us..." This tense's suffix according to vowel harmony is: -e, -a Conditional Tense (Dilek Şart Kipi)This tense signifies the condition of an event "If.. Lest..". İş veya oluşun, hareketin meydan gelmesi bir şarta bağlıdır. This tense's suffix according to vowel harmony is -se, -sa. Imperative Tense (Emir Kipi)This tense signifies orders, advice or warnings.
